Six West Sussex Relatives Convicted on 39 Counts in Multi‑Year Abuse of Two Sisters

Sentencing is scheduled for February 2026 following 39 guilty verdicts at Hove Crown Court.

Overview

  • The father, two brothers and the grandfather were convicted of sexual offences against the older girl, while the mother was found guilty of child cruelty and false imprisonment.
  • The mother and the uncle were also convicted of perverting the course of justice for pressuring the child to change her account while the family was on bail.
  • The case came to light when the older sister told school staff she was too frightened to return home, prompting a Sussex Police investigation and specialist safeguarding support.
  • Jurors deliberated for more than 20 hours before returning the verdicts on 39 of 42 charges after a trial that began in mid‑September.
  • Police say the sisters remain under specialist care and have urged the public to avoid online speculation to protect the victims’ legal anonymity.
